How Can I Deduct Rental Car Costs On My Income Tax?

Thursday, March 18th, 2010

One of the popular questions asked related to tax is “Can I deduct rental car costs on my income tax?”. Many countries impose massive taxes on rental cars. Rental car companies are becoming more infuriated with the increasing taxes imposed on their clients.

Unfortunately, it is not easy to avoid these taxes, according to the Coalition Against Discriminatory Car Rental Excise Taxes. In 43 of the United States of America, there are a total of 114 different local and state excise taxes for leasing and or renting cars. In the 1990s, there were only fourteen such taxes. The CADCRET was formed in order to track and fight the proliferation of taxes.

Residents of Maine blocked a new state tax-reform law that proposed a 10-12,5% increase in car rentals. The petition managed to put the increase on hold for a while at least. This is a great relief for business travelers in particular as well as rental car companies and corporate travel departments.

Some cities charge as much as 20% in car rental taxes and cost Fortune 100 companies upwards of $5 million per year.

Taxes are imposed in order for cities to close gaps within their budgets. This has not made the car hire companies excited at all. They do not want to be associated with tax collection and they have to charge higher prices to accommodate the taxes. Subconsciously clients blame the care and truck rental companies for this. 36 months ago 8 rental brands and the National Business Travel Association formed a group to lobby against the taxes. They also took it upon themselves to provide education for consumers.

In New Jersey there is tax reform passed that permits municipalities to impose 5 % excise tax when people rent cars. As it is car renters already pay a whopping $5 daily in the form of sales tax and state tax.

Don’t rent a car in Wisconsin as you will be expected to pay $18 every time you rent a vehicle. The money from this tax is supposedly used to assist in the funding of a mass- transit project. This would translate to a tax increase of in excess of seventy percent in Milwaukee, Kenosha and Racine.

The lobbyist group also reports that in Michigan there is pending legislation that will, if passed increase taxes by a further $2.50 per transaction.

In order to find funding for rail projects in Florida. The people responsible for the law are fighting to increase the taxes by a further $2.00. This would mean the tax increases by 50!

The general consensus of these people who make the laws is that this tax is necessary and understandable. These sentiments receive fierce opposition for the coalition.

The recession has hit the states in America in a big way and the deficits in state coffers is horrendous to say the least.

It appears there is misappropriation of funds as when a project is complete then the money is used elsewhere. This explains some of the reasons that car renters are asking, “can I deduct car rental costs on my income tax?

Top Tips On Affordable Car Rentals

Saturday, March 13th, 2010

So you are looking for a car rental but are a little concerned about spending too much money. You wish there was a guide to help you through the process, one that would ensure that you don’t spend too much. Well, you have finally landed on just that the following are the key points of car hire that everyone who is renting a vehicle needs to know.

1. There’s Always A Discount Rate- Several individuals will assure you there are zero discount rates to be offered in the automobile hire industry. This is plainly not the truth. Although a lot of companies are keeping their rates stabilized during this economical downswing, you would discover that you will be able to ascertain internet discounts as well as promotional codes upon the internet. You will be able to likewise inquire about the specials companies are extending or discount rates that they have forthcoming to assist with more savings.

2. Watch The Mileage- a lot of companies don’t gain much profit on their primary fees, thus they incline towards making it up with billing for mileage or overages in miles that could add up to rather quite a bit of extra bucks. Instead select to rent cars that might cost a little more but offer unlimited mileage, this will wind up protecting you from spending more money then you had budgeted for.

3. Be Knowledgeable Of Your Insurance Coverage- You need not need to purchase supplemental insurance through the rental company if you’re covered through your charge card, automobile insurance or both. Learning about your insurance policy options beforehand is a great method to save yourself a lot of money on the insurance policy, as well as if something materializes with the vehicle.

4. Be Able To Change Your Plans- There is a great possibility that you will be able to get a cheaper car rental, if you are flexible on your travel dates. Changing the dates of your drop off and pick up, as well as the month that you are renting can change your rental price drastically.

Rental Arrangement Suitable To Your Holiday Experience

Wednesday, March 10th, 2010

While visiting Queensland, it is important that you are aware of the rules, when you are traveling through the outback. Before you enter the road, you are required to contact the police and let them know where you are heading. Once you reach your destination, you are then required to make another phone call to the police and inform them of your arrival. This is an important procedure, so that if you are not at your destination and the approximate time of your arrival, they police will be able to easily find you. It is also important to know that although you can travel these roads with a car, the best choice of vehicle is a 4 WD.

It is also important, that while you are traveling, you are prepared, should anything go wrong with your transportation. Any spare parts that you may need, such as tires, should be in tow, since the roads are extremely remote, and it can take hours for a tow truck just to reach you. A mobile phone, is not the most reliable communication device, in the outback, so another great item that you should travel with is a high frequency out post radio transmitter, equipped to pick up the Royal Flying Doctor Service bases.

Another essential item, that you should always have on you, is water. It is recommended that you carry at least 20 litres of water per person, as well as an ample supply of food. There are also certain times of the year that makes a road more easily traveled on then others. From November to March, it is not recommended that you travel Queensland’s south west, due to an abundance of dust that can increase mechanical problems. While in the North, it is not recommended that you travel during the rainy season, as the roads tend to get flooded.

To avoid making these mistakes and ensuring you are literally on the right track, it is useful to speak to the local police. They can advise you which tracks are open and if your car is suitable. It may be useful also to join the RACQ, (Royal Automobile Club of Queensland), as it offers emergency breakdown cover for $95 per year and a 24 hour telephone service. This will ensure prompt roadside assistance and they will organize a tow if the problem cant be fixed on site. The RACQ also provides lots of sets of regional maps of Queenslands and sells a wide range of travel and driving products. It provides advice on weather and road conditions.

If you should happen to come into car trouble sit is very important that you remain with your car, as it is easier to spot a car then it is to spot a person. Never wander off into the wilderness, as individuals have been found dead, from thirst, long after their car was found.

Three Things To Check Before Hitting The Road With Your Next Car Hire

Thursday, March 4th, 2010

When you are traveling there are many things that you will need to think about. To start with, you will need to make all your reservations. Then you will need to take the long travel haul, where you are exhausted by the time you reach your destination. This tiredness can cause you to be neglectful or just rush through some of arrangement that you will then need to confirm and sign for. Whatever you do, it is important that you carefully read through any agreements with your car rental company before you sign. No matter how tired you are, this is a step that can not be done half way.

Before you drive your rental off of the property you will want to be sure to check a few things. Some of these things can be done before you even leave for vacation, and by doing so you will save yourself a lot of headaches and time when you arrive at your destination. Three things that you will be able to do prior to leaving for your vacation are outlined for you in this article.

The Contract- Before you sign anything you must carefully review even line and detail of the rental agreement. Closer attention should be given to areas that you are required to initial next to. Obviously initialing near these areas makes them an especially important clause and therefore requires extra attention.

Emergency Road Service- You want to have a complete understanding on what your road service assistance will be should a problem arise. Although many rental companies offer emergency roadside assist, the procedure for contacting the service may vary. Some companies will provide you with a phone number to call, others will expect you to take certain steps for getting the service covered. You will want to be fully knowledge on the procedure for the company you are renting from, otherwise it could cost you a large amount of money when you return your rental to the company.

Know The Vehicle You Are Driving- Preceding to driving away from the lot, be sure to give the vehicle a fine look-over. Check into the fluid levels, the bodily appearance of the rental and discover where everything is. Areas to give special attention to include where the switch over for the headlamps is placed, how to turn your wiper blades on and off, and the placements of the emergency brake and the hazard lights. In addition to all this, if the vehicle uses a GPS navigation system, then have the leasing broker exhibit you how to work it.

Tips On Smooth International Car Rental Transactions

Sunday, February 21st, 2010

Renting a car seems like a simple enough process. You shop around and find the best deal, book it and pick it up. When you are renting a vehicle internationally, however, there are some additional things that you must be aware of.

To start with you may be required to obtain an international driving permit in order to rent a vehicle at an overseas destination. This permit is not always required for your international travel rental, but it is mandatory by many other countries. If required, your international driving permit needs to be obtained prior to leaving your country, therefore you will want to look into this several weeks in advance to ensure that if the permit is required you have enough time to get the documentation and paperwork together. In addition to needing an international driving permit, many countries also require that you have a valid drivers license so you will want to be sure that you have both documents on you when you go to pick up your rental.

Even if a country reciprocates with your country and allows you to drive on your driver\’s license alone, you will still probably need to obtain an international insurance card, proving that you are insured. Since many insurance companies are regionally located, this insurance card will let the rental agent know that you carry valid insurance and are eligible to lease a vehicle. Again this paperwork must be obtained from your homeland, so be sure to find out exactly what the rental agency will need from you in order to rent a vehicle.

While traveling internationally it is also a wise idea to go with a reputable company that you are familiar with. Since many of the same rental companies from the United States are located around the world this should not be a hard task. Once you have reserved your rental you should then include anything additional that you will need while driving. Many companies offer child safety seats, car racks, GPS devices and other travel necessities, to their customers. These items should be reserved way in advance of your arrival as there is often a limited supply on hand. Another good idea is to always rent a GPS, if they are available. This will not only assist you with traveling on the unfamiliar roads, it will also assist in finding emergency services, gas locations and other areas that you may be in need of while traveling.

If you are knowledgeable on what you will need, and book far in advance, international car rentals can be a smooth process. Be sure to arrange everything before you leave, have all the required documents and when you arrange you can go through the formality of the paperwork and be on your way to enjoying your vacation.
